Historical Context of Political Spouses

Throughout American history, the role of the First Lady or political spouse has been far from static. Early figures in this position often maintained a largely private and domestic presence, focusing on family and social hosting duties. As the 20th century progressed, some political spouses began to take on more visible public roles, championing social causes, engaging with the media, and shaping public policy indirectly through advocacy and influence.

The diversity in approaches to this role reflects the unique personalities and priorities of each individual. Some embraced the spotlight and became active political partners, while others preferred a more reserved and selective engagement with public life. This variation underscores that there is no single blueprint for how political spouses navigate their responsibilities.

Media Representation and Gender Dynamics

Media portrayal of political spouses frequently intersects with gender expectations and stereotypes. Female political spouses, in particular, have historically faced scrutiny over their appearance, demeanor, and adherence to traditional roles. This focus can overshadow their substantive contributions or complex identities.

Understanding the influence of gender dynamics in media coverage is essential for a comprehensive view of political spouses’ public experiences. It encourages critical examination of how narratives are constructed and the ways in which these narratives may reinforce or challenge societal norms. Greater awareness of these dynamics can help audiences appreciate the diverse ways political spouses navigate their public roles while confronting gendered expectations.
